#4df88c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4df88c is composed of 30.2% red, 97.3%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.5%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 142.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.4% and a lightness of 63.7%. #4df88c color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#00f119.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#4df88c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4df88c has RGB values of R:77, G:248,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 5109900.

Shades and Tints of #4df88c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000b04 is the darkest color, while #f7fffa is the lightest one.
